获取可信计算节点详情
功能介绍
本接口用于获取可信计算节点详情。
- 返回信息包括空间id、可信计算节点id、部署方式、审计方式等。
- 可信计算节点互信失败信息也可从此接口获取。
调用方法
请参见如何调用API。
URI
GET /v1/agents
请求参数
|
参数 |
是否必选 |
参数类型 |
描述 |
|---|---|---|---|
|
X-Auth-Token |
是 |
String |
用户Token。 通过调用接口获取用户Token接口获取。 |
|
X-Language |
是 |
String |
根据自己偏好的语言来获取不同语言的返回内容,zh-cn或者en_us |
|
Content-Type |
是 |
String |
消息体的类型(格式),必选,默认取值为“application/json”,有其他取值时会在具体接口中专门说明。 |
响应参数
状态码: 200
|
参数 |
参数类型 |
描述 |
|---|---|---|
|
trusted |
String |
互信状态,“true”表示互信,“false”表示不互信 |
|
status |
String |
节点状态,“ONLINE”表示节点在线,“OFFLINE”表示节点离线。 |
|
agent_id |
String |
可信计算节点id |
|
agent_name |
String |
可信计算节点名称 |
|
project_id |
String |
项目id |
|
league_id |
String |
空间ID |
|
league_name |
String |
空间名称 |
|
cluster_type |
String |
部署类别:cce部署、ief部署、外部可信计算节点 |
|
storage_type |
String |
挂载类别:主机挂载、obs挂载 |
|
cce_vpc_id |
String |
cce节点所在的vpc id |
|
bcs_enable |
String |
是否开启bcs审计 |
|
bcs_endpoint |
String |
bcs浏览器地址 |
|
error_msg |
String |
互信失败错误信息 |
请求示例
可信计算节点详情展示
get https://x.x.x.x:12345/v1/agents
响应示例
状态码: 200
可信计算节点详情
{
"trusted" : "true",
"status" : "ONLINE",
"agent_id" : "5623a01db3b949b89a2b183f69a6e8ef",
"agent_name" : "agent_arm",
"project_id" : "098593b0***004a482da10",
"league_id" : "98fbc33a1b854c6f8c17c8758061e33b",
"league_name" : "test0331",
"cluster_type" : "IEF",
"storage_type" : "HOST_PATH",
"cce_vpc_id" : "",
"bcs_enable" : "false",
"bcs_endpoint" : ":30603",
"error_msg" : ""
}
状态码
|
状态码 |
描述 |
|---|---|
|
200 |
可信计算节点详情 |
|
401 |
操作无权限 |
|
500 |
内部服务器错误 |